Handbook of Drug Administration via Enteral Feeding Tubes is a practical guide to the safe administration of medicines via enteral feeding tubes.
Ten chapters provide the background knowledge to inform clinical decisions and the accompanying 343 monographs contain guidance on the safe administration of specific drugs and formulations.
Contents include:- Types of enteral feeding tubes
- Tube flushing
- Restoring and maintaining patency
- Drug therapy review, medication formulation choice
- Unlicensed medication use
- Health and safety and interactions
Handbook of Drug Administration via Enteral Feeding Tubes is an essential guide for pharmacists, doctors, nurses, dieticians, nursing homes and hospices.
